“We need the influence of the Holy Ghost in our lives, and we need to recognize how that influence can help us to walk in the covenant path,” Elder Soares said in Spanish as he spoke from Salt Lake City, Utah.

 Elder Soares of the Quorum of the Twelve emphasized listening to the Spirit and recognizing it to youth in the Caribbean during the devotional For the Strength of Youth conference from July 26-30. 

More than 2,000 youth from 27 countries in the Caribbean participated in the in weeklong virtual conference. The activities were broadcasted in English, Spanish and French. 

Elder Soares also emphasized the importance of Individual and regular prayer, scripture study, obeying, doing family history, attending seminary, obeying the commandments, providing service and acting on prophets’ teachings.

“Our task is to study our concerns, carefully decide the direction we should follow. Then, in sincere prayer and with true intent, we should go to the Lord and then we should listen,” he said.  

These answers can come in feelings, such as the “sweet assurance that only comes from the Holy Ghost.”  

“President Nelson taught that repeating this process regularly will help us grow in the principle of revelation,” Elder Soares spoke. 

There are times when the Lord doesn’t give a specific answer, such as with the Brother of Jared and how to have light in the boats, Elder Soares said. There are also decisions where there could be multiple correct answers, such as where to go to school, career paths or where to live.  

“Each one of us wants to receive answers to the questions that we have for you to be successful in life as well,” he said. “It is very important to do our part to qualify to receive the impression of the Holy Ghost.” 

He also noted that trials are part of life and at many times they can be  overwhelming.  

“One of the great lessons that I have learned in my life is to see trials through the eyes of faith,” Elder Soares said.  

Strength to work through trials and to push away temptations comes through seeking the Lord, he said.  

“I testify that as we put our trust in Him and follow His counsel our capacity to avoid temptation will increase significantly,” he said. “Our spiritual maturity will grow at a higher rate each time, and the influence of the Holy Ghost will be more intense and more constant in our lives. And, therefore, we will have a happier, purer and more consecrated life.”
